Use this slot to install an SD memory card (a type of SD card containing an SLC chip) for backup purposes.
This enables alarm video, backup video in the event of network failures, log information, and other data to be
stored with the camera.
You can format the SD memory card via network operation on the SD MEMORY CARD screen.
The power indicator will blink if an error occurs on the SD memory card.
How to insert the SD card
Turn off the camera and remove the protective cap. Then, with the label side facing down, insert an SD memory
card until you hear a click.
How to remove the SD card
Push the SD card a bit further into the slot to eject it.
Before removing the SD card, follow one of the steps below.
Set [SD MEMORY CARD] to "NO USE" on the SD MEMORY CARD screen via network operation.
Or, press the NEAR button provided on the left-side face of the camera for 2 seconds or more.
Doing so causes the power indicator to start blinking and then stay lit when the camera is ready for
you to remove the SD memory card.
